The latest Daily Mail survey shows Trump still edging out Harris nationally by two percentage points, garnering 43 percent support to Harris’s 41 percent support. However, that two-point gap is outside the ± 3.1 percent margin of error, setting up what the Daily Mail describes as a “nail-biter of an election in November.”
The outlet cites another survey, as well, which shows respondents largely viewing Trump as the more “strong” and “charismatic” candidate.
James Johnson, co-founder of J.L. Partners, said that while Harris has made headway with young voters, black voters, and independents, Trump still has a more energized base. Further, he said Trump “has held his position with whites, Hispanics, and voters over the age of 50.”
“Harris’s biggest support remains relatively limited to 18 to 49-year-olds. A lot of this is due to Trump’s dominance on the issues of the economy and the border,” he observed, adding, “But at the moment we are looking at a race made tighter, rather than transformed to a Harris shoo-in.”
